Several key factors are driving the expansion of the FRP water softener tank market. The rising prevalence of hard water in many regions is a major catalyst. Hard water leads to scaling in pipes, appliances, and plumbing fixtures, resulting in decreased efficiency, increased maintenance costs, and shortened lifespan of equipment. FRP tanks offer a durable and cost-effective solution to this problem, as they resist corrosion and scaling better than traditional materials like steel. Additionally, the increasing demand for high-quality water in both residential and commercial settings is fueling market growth. Consumers are increasingly prioritizing water quality, leading to greater adoption of water softening systems, including those using FRP tanks. The eco-friendly nature of FRP, compared to some other materials, also contributes to its popularity. FRP tanks are recyclable and their production generates less waste, aligning with growing environmental concerns. Furthermore, the relatively lightweight nature of FRP makes installation and transportation easier and less expensive than heavier alternatives. These combined factors create a strong foundation for the continued growth of the FRP water softener tank market in the coming years.
Despite the promising growth trajectory, the FRP water softener tank market faces certain challenges. The initial investment cost for a water softening system can be a significant barrier for some consumers, particularly in developing economies. This cost factor can hinder market penetration, especially among budget-conscious individuals or businesses. Furthermore, the susceptibility of FRP to UV degradation in prolonged sun exposure can pose a limitation. While advancements are continuously being made to improve UV resistance, it remains a factor to consider, particularly for outdoor installations. Competition from alternative materials like stainless steel and plastic also presents a challenge. While FRP offers distinct advantages, the availability and potentially lower cost of these materials can impact market share. Lastly, maintaining consistent quality control in the manufacturing of FRP tanks is crucial to ensuring durability and performance. Inconsistent quality can damage the reputation of the product and deter customers. Addressing these challenges through technological advancements, targeted marketing, and strong quality control measures is crucial for continued market growth.
